Transgender Day of Remembrance was founded in 1999 by Gwendolyn Ann Smith and JMEL a transgender woman, [337] to memorialize the murder of transgender woman Rita Hester in Allston, Massachusetts. The first rainbow pride flag was designed by Gilbert Baker and unveiled during the San Francisco Gay Freedom Day on June 25, 1978. This flag contained hot pink, red, orange, yellow, green ...
